> >> Could anyone share their experience getting from Luton Airport to
> >> Central London? Is it a good idea to take the EasyBus service? They
> >> offer cheap advance online tickets, but in practise, how predictable is
> >> your arrival at the airport if you fly in with Easyjet? Are there better
> >> travelling alternatives?
> >>
> >The frequent free shuttle bus to the nearby Luton airport railway station
> >is a good alternative and worked well for me recently. You can buy a
> >combined ticket including underground travel and busses in London with
> >London transport.
>
> IIRC when you arrive back in London on the train there is a bit of a
> walk to the nearest Tube.

Depends where you arrive back in "London"- the train can stop at several
different stations. St. Pancras, Kings Cross Thameslink, Blackfriars,
London Bridge etc. St. Pancras had the biggest walk, but I haven't used
it for a couple of years, so maybe the CTRL work affecting the tube
station is over now.
